About this opportunity

The World Bank Group runs this as its flagship leadership development programme, hiring early career professionals into a two-year staff appointment spanning the World Bank, IFC and MIGA. New Young Professionals start in Washington, DC and complete three rotations of eight months each, with at least one based in a country office. Finishing the programme leads to a further five-year contract.

What you get:

  • A two-year staff appointment at GF level, with a salary and a full benefits package
  • A further five-year contract on successful completion, renewable after that
  • Three rotations of eight months across the World Bank, IFC and MIGA, including at least one country office posting
  • A place in the YP Academy, a two-year curriculum covering onboarding, language learning, business and leadership skills, and operational training
  • Dedicated mentorship and direct engagement with senior leaders
  • Travel, accommodation and reasonable expenses covered if you are invited to a panel interview

What you'll do:

  • Apply under one of two tracks, Operations or Specialized Functions, and pick a technical stream such as education, health, climate, water, transport, digital transformation, legal or economic policy
  • Complete one rotation in your primary function, one cross-institutional rotation, and at least one rotation based in a country office
  • Work on projects across the World Bank Group regions, from agricultural reconstruction in post-conflict settings to infrastructure finance
  • Write two personal statements of up to 400 words each, and a 250 word account of your qualifications for your chosen stream

Key dates:

  • Application portal opens September 1, 2026
  • Applications close September 30, 2026 at 11:59 PM UTC. Late applications are not considered
  • Applications reviewed October 1 to 15, 2026, with the top 10 percent taken forward
  • Virtual interviews and assessments October 15 to 31, 2026
  • Panel interviews and case studies in Washington DC and Nairobi in December 2026, or Paris and Bangkok in January 2027
  • Offers sent late January to early February 2027
  • New cohort starts in Washington, DC in September 2027

Who can apply

  • Minimum masters-level degree or higher in a relevant field, completed before the September start date
  • Two to six years of professional experience in a related area. Full-time doctoral research in a relevant field may count, and the degree must be substantially complete before the September start
  • Nationality of a World Bank Group member country, shown by an officially issued passport
  • Excellent command of spoken and written English is mandatory. Other languages may strengthen an application
  • You cannot be a current World Bank Group staff member. Interns whose assignment ends by September 30 may apply
  • No close relative working at the World Bank Group, and no spouse in a supervisory relationship
  • No age requirement
  • Documents to upload: a CV of one page ideally and two at most, your passport photo page, and transcripts or enrolment letters for post-graduate degrees
  • Two references are requested only if you reach the offer stage
